I only have experience with two wildcats, 338-06 Ackley Improved and 30 Herrett. I recently acquired a Contender G2 carbine from a friend’s estate. It is chambered in 6.5x50R Bellm. I have ammunition formed from RWS 5.6x50R Mag and new brass. I also have is pet load recipe. I have dies that he labeled the box as for the Bellm, but are 6.5 TCU dies. I can’t see where these dies could be used to resize this brass. For those that reload this cartridge what dies do you use? Where did you acquire them? Are there any good sources for others load data? I cannot find any on Ammoguide or load data sites. Any information would be greatly appreciated. | ||

Paul H posted this in respect of the 6.5x50R BELLM on AR in a discussion on the various 6.5's some years ago. Note he says standard 6.5 TCU dies are used to reload the 6.5x50R BELLM. "I haven't owned a 6.5X50R, yet but have seen one, and know another shooting buddy who has one. The case is the 5.6X50R necked up, and I'm pretty sure the shoulder is moved forward. It is improved, and then some, the neck is very short. In a 14" contender, it is the fastest 6.5mm, pushing 120's 2500 fps, which is an honest 100 fps faster then any of the other 6.5's. It also uses std 6.5 TCU dies, and one can simply get a used 6.5 TCU and have it re-chambered". | |||

I was able to get in contact via email with Mr. Mike Bellm. He passed on the data that I needed. Also, the steps for reloading using the 6.5 TCU and 357 dies that I have. He was extremely helpful. I would be glad to pass on the information to anyone in need of it. I will probably have a set of dies made by Hornady to make it a little easier. | |||
